Ingredients
- 2 Bananas ripe
- 150 g Sifted flour
- 2 tsp Baking powder
- 50 g Ground almonds
- 1 tbsp Chocolate chips, or chopped chocolate
- 1 tbsp Chopped almonds
- 3 Eggs, M or L
- 150 g Sugar, white or brown
- 150 g Butter at room temperature or margarine
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 180 degrees circulating air. Take out the trays, leave only the grid on the middle rail. Use a 12-cup muffin tray for large muffins. Grease the coolers well or put in paper cases. Then it starts.
- Mix the eggs with sugar into a whitish cream until frothy. Stir in butter or margarine at room temperature. Peel the ripe, soft bananas and crush them with a fork and stir in as well.
- Mix the flour with the ground nuts and baking powder. Make sure that the baking soda does not have any lumps. Briefly stir the flour mixture into the dough.
- Now fold in the chopped nuts and chocolate with the spatula.
- Spread the dough evenly in the mold. Then in the oven and bake for 20 minutes. If nothing sticks to the stick test with a toothpick, remove the muffin tin and let the muffins cool.
